Victor Celebrates The Arts is a judged show and will be celebrating our 20th year.
Judging is done by an established and respected professional artist. Professional and non-professional artists participate in painting various scenes within rustic Victor and many legendary 1890’s gold mining sites nearby.
Our show captures national attention. We invite you to join us as a participating artist as well as the public at large for this exciting and unique event. We expect dozens of artists to participate, with more than 20 awards to be presented with total cash prizes of over $4,000.00.
Thousands of visitors from many states attend the show and enjoy watching the artists painting around Victor.
Victor, CO, an historic town of 400 residents, is an unpolished gem of 1890’s gold mining history.
Victor is located on the sunny side of Pike’s Peak with great southern exposure, one hour west of Colorado Springs and 5-miles from Cripple Creek. Victor has panoramic views of the Sangre de Cristo Mountains, blue skies, fresh mountain air, alpine wild flowers, evergreens and aspens, all at an elevation of nearly 10,000 feet.
The natural beauty is breathtaking and an inspiration for the artist and all visitors alike.
Brush Rush Event:
Sunday, September 1: 9 a.m. – 12 p.m.
Registered artists check-in at Victor Elks Lodge front porch. Artwork will be available for sale after the event at the show. Canvases must be stamped, maximum dimension 14” x 18”, one painting per artist, no framing is permitted. Completed artwork must be checked in at the Elks Lodge. Judging follows starting at 12:30. The public is welcome to view artists as they paint on-site.
Quick Draw Event
Monday, September 2: 9 a.m. – 12 p.m.
Registered artists check-in with Coordinator at Wallace Park. Live models, props, and historic Victor scenery are subject matter. Judging on-site. The public is welcome to view the artists paint and participate in judging at the conclusion of the event.
